Output f50baae446c62868c18b4e617cfcf6bfee2104d5febddc33fe160b562287cf7e:0

value
6331500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ec919a31058aad129a2e7e1bb2c6617c8d3983ee OP_EQUAL
address
3PFspSZsho7nhKg75pj9X3X2iX2KUWVBwK
transaction
f50baae446c62868c18b4e617cfcf6bfee2104d5febddc33fe160b562287cf7e
spent
true